Seasoned Journalist Kwesi Pratt Jnr. has called on the Electoral Commission to uproot any staff members who bear political affiliations.
Speaking on Peace FM's morning show "Kokrokoo", Mr. Pratt gave accounts of some members of the management of the Electoral Commission publicly declaring their support for specific political parties, and, to him, such behavior is extremely condemnable.
He cautioned the commissioners against having political inclinations, saying it affects the credibility of the commission.
"Card-bearing party members have no place in the Electoral Commission," he stated.
